Exponential lower bound for the eigenvalues of the time-frequency localization operator before the plunge region

arXiv:2306.12430

Abstract

We prove that the eigenvalues of the time-frequency localization operator satisfy for , where and is arbitrary, improving on the result of Bonami, Jaming and Karoui, who proved it for . The proof is based on the properties of the Bargmann transform.
